手机版 收藏 导航

如何在浏览器中查看IP地址的端口信息

原创   www.link114.cn   2024-07-09 20:51:03

如何在浏览器中查看IP地址的端口信息

查看IP地址是最常见的需求之一。通过浏览器可以有多种方式来获取IP地址信息。

1. 使用特殊网站

有许多专门用于显示IP地址的网站,如whatismyipaddress.comipify.org等。只需在浏览器中访问这些网站,就可以直接看到自己的IP地址。这种方式简单直接,但需要联网才能使用。

2. 使用JavaScript

我们也可以通过在网页中嵌入JavaScript代码来获取IP地址。以下是一个简单的例子:


<script>
  function getIPAddress() {
    var xhr = new XMLHttpRequest();
    xhr.open('GET', 'https://api.ipify.org?format=json', true);
    xhr.onload = function() {
      if (xhr.status === 200) {
        var data = JSON.parse(xhr.responseText);
        document.getElementById('ip-address').textContent = data.ip;
      }
    };
    xhr.send();
  }
</script>

<button onclick="getIPAddress()">查看IP地址</button>
<div id="ip-address"></div>

这段代码会在页面上添加一个按钮,点击后会通过调用getIPAddress()函数来获取IP地址并显示在页面上。这种方式不需要联网,但需要用户手动触发。

除IP地址,我们有时还需要知道当前正在使用的端口信息。以下是几种通过浏览器查看端口信息的方法。

1. 使用浏览器开发者工具

大多数浏览器都内置开发者工具,可以帮助我们查看网页的各种信息,包括端口信息。以Chrome为例,可以按F12或右键点击页面选择"检查"来打开开发者工具,切换到"网络"标签页即可看到当前页面请求的端口信息。

2. 使用JavaScript

我们也可以通过JavaScript代码获取端口信息。下面是一个简单的示例:


<script>
  function getPortInfo() {
    var port = window.location.port;
    document.getElementById('port-info').textContent = 'Port: ' + port;
  }
</script>

<button onclick="getPortInfo()">查看端口信息</button>
<div id="port-info"></div>

这段代码会在页面上添加一个按钮,点击后会调用getPortInfo()函数来获取当前页面使用的端口信息并显示在页面上。需要注意的是,页面是通过本地文件(file://)访问的,则无法获取端口信息,因为本地文件没有端口号。

通过以上方法,我们可以很方便地在浏览器中查看IP地址和端口信息。无论是使用专门的网站,还是利用JavaScript代码,都可以快速得到我们需要的网络信息。掌握这些技巧不仅可以帮助我们解决一些网络问题,也可以让我们更好地了解自己的网络环境。希望这篇文章对你有所帮助。